Position Overview:

The Chief of Staff (CoS) will serve as a trusted strategic partner to the Executive team (primarily the CEO and CFO), helping align the firm’s vision with operational execution. This role is designed for a proactive, highly organized professional who can balance big-picture strategy with day-to-day operational details. The CoS will act as a force multiplier for leadership—facilitating decision-making, driving accountability across departments, and ensuring strategic initiatives are implemented effectively.

Key Responsibilities:

Strategic Leadership & Alignment

  • Monitor responses and ensure timely follow-up. Partner with the Executive team (primarily the CEO and CFO) to define, track, and execute firm-wide strategic priorities.
  • Ensure alignment across departments (financial planning, investment management, operations, marketing, compliance, HR).
  • Drive communication and follow-up on key decisions, initiatives, and metrics.

Operational Excellence

  • Serve as project manager for cross-functional initiatives, ensuring deadlines and deliverables are met.
  • Identify bottlenecks, recommend solutions, and optimize workflows across the firm.
  • Track KPIs and business performance, preparing dashboards and executive summaries for leadership.

Executive Support & Communication

  • Manage executive-level meetings: set agendas, facilitate discussions, ensure action items are captured and executed.
  • Support the CEO and CFO with board reporting, capital partner relations, and strategic communications.
  • Act as a sounding board and proxy for the Executive team in internal discussions and external engagements when needed.

Culture & Team Development

  • Help foster a high-performance, client-centric culture aligned with Pure’s values.
  • Partner with HR on leadership development, team engagement, and organizational structure.
  • Support recruiting and onboarding of senior or advisor hires. 

Special Projects / M&A

  • Lead and/or support key strategic initiatives, such as mergers & acquisitions and the due diligence and integrations thereof, with additional initiatives across technology adoption, client experience innovation, and process improvement.
  • Support and/or lead financial modeling and deal structuring of mergers and acquisitions.
  • Perform ad hoc research, financial analyses and general business analyses to inform executive decision-making.

Qualifications:

  • Bachelor’s degree in business, finance, or related field; MBA or advanced degree preferred.
  • 5+ years of progressive experience in strategy, operations, investment banking, consulting or private equity roles (financial services/RIA industry experience preferred but not required).
  • Exceptional organizational and project management skills.
  • Strong financial and analytical acumen, with the ability to interpret data and drive actionable insights.
  • Outstanding written and verbal communication skills; able to adapt across audiences.
  • Demonstrated ability to influence without direct authority and to navigate complex organizational dynamics.
  • High emotional intelligence, discretion, and integrity.
